Beer isn't just a great beverage. It is also a major contributor to Canadian prosperity and our high quality of life. Each year, the brewing industry contributes just under $14 billion to the economy. In fact, brewers account for 12% of the GDP generated by the entire domestic food manufacturing industry.

Note: All volume statistics are reported by calendar year (i.e., January 1 to December 31). Unit of measure is the hectolitre. Per capita numbers are measured in litres. One hectolitre equals approximately 12.2 cases of 24 bottles (341 ml each bottle) or 11.7 cases of 24 cans (355 ml each can).
